Michael Domenic Onorato, age 35, of Swarthmore, PA, formerly of South Philadelph­ia, PA passed away suddenly on November 22, 2018.

He attended Saint Nicholas of Tolentine Elementary School and later Our Lady of Peace and Notre Dame de Lourdes schools, a graduate of Ridley High School and earned his Associates Degree at DCCC in Business Administra­tion. Growing up his nickname was “OPH.” He played football for Swarthmore­wood, basketball for Our Lady of Peace, and baseball for Father Knoll CYO. He loved watching all Philadelph­ia sports teams, especially the Flyers and Eagles.

His passion was cooking, always could be found in the kitchen, helping his mom, especially making the meatballs and homemade gnocchi. He worked at Italian Village as a pizza maker, cook at the Blue Moon restaurant and the Corinthian Yacht Club. He was most recently worked with his father at Allstate as a Property and Casualty Sales Producer.

He had a great sense of humor. He was kind, generous and loving. He was very family oriented, having a very special place in his heart for his nephew, Luciano.

Michael is survived by his parents Richard and Lorraine (Cookie) Onorato. His brothers Richard and Victor (Katie), his sister, Michelle Bailor (Robert) as well as many uncles, aunts, cousins, nieces, nephews and dear friends.
